Recap / Samurai Rabbit The Usagi Chronicles S 1 E 1 The Big City

Go To

Young Yuichi Usagi dreams of becoming a samurai like his famous ancestor Miyamoto Usagi. To that end, he leaves his auntie's farm behind to find adventure in the city of Neo Edo. However, upon arriving he finds that his ancestor is remembered as a villain and as Miyamoto's descendant, Yuichi isn't looked upon fondly either.


Tropes:

  • Acting Out a Daydream: Yuichi starts to become so engrossed in his fantasy, he starts wildly swinging his sword around with closed eyes. While driving a steamcycle through a bustling city. Later on he starts narrating yet another Imagine Spot, only for Gen to call him out for being insulting, revealing that Yuichi said his narration out loud.
  • Bait-and-Switch: When Yuichi tells his auntie he's made up his mind about leaving for Neo Edo, she pulls Edgewing on him. Yuichi nervously says he didn't think she'd be that mad about it, only for his auntie to agree that she can't stop him and give him her old weapon so he'll have an easier time finding a sensei in Neo Edo.
  • Damned by Faint Praise: Kitsune calls the Mogura the third most dangerous gang in Neo Edo. Chikabuma's not amused.
  • Did I Just Say That Out Loud?: When Yuichi narrates his Imagine Spot, Gen takes offense to Yuichi's rather unflattering description of him. Yuichi is embarrassed that he actually narrated out loud.
  • Establishing Character Moment: After gushing to his pet Spot about his famous ancestor Miyamoto, Usagi proceeds to practice some moves on his auntie's farmbotto, only to accidentally activate it and lay waste to the farm. This gives us basically all we need to know about Yuichi in a few scenes. He's Miyamoto's descendant, he admires and wants to be like his ancestor and he's often reckless.
  • Gilligan Cut: Yuichi promises his auntie that he'll treat Edgewing with respect and that he'll find himself a sensei as soon as he reaches Neo Edo. The very next scene he's swinging Edgewing around like a toy, while loudly declaring that he'll never get a sensei, because he already knows everything.
  • Heroic Wannabe: Yuichi's eagerness to be a heroic samurai causes him to rush into situations without assessing them first. Because of this, Yuichi ends up hurting people more than he helps.
  • Identical Grandson: Aside from the slightly more youthful features, Yuichi is the spitting image of his ancestor Miyamoto. Kagehito actually thinks Yuichi is Miyamoto upon seeing him and continues to believe that even when Yuichi immediately corrects him.
  • Idiot Ball: After already having been told that his presence somehow causes the Ki-Stone to act up, Yuichi still decides it would be a good idea to go and take a closer look at the artifact. Preditably, this goes horribly wrong.
  • Imagine Spot: While driving through Neo Edo, Yuichi fantasizes about first slaying a group of thugs, then being granted the power of the Ki-Stone to battle yokai. He has another when he confronts Gen to protect the "innocent" pig Gen is threatening, in which he imagines himself in traditional samurai garb and the alley as part of an old-edo style village.
  • Nice Job Breaking It, Hero: Honestly, it would be more challenging to find a moment in the episode where Yuichi doesn't mess up. Highlights include:
    • Letting a notorious thief get away, ruining the efforts of the bounty hunter who tracked him down.
    • Landing on Kitsune's puppet theatre and kidnapping her puppet in the process.
    • Jumping out of a manhole with so much force, he ends up completely destroying a bunch of priceless vases.
    • And breaking the Ki-Stone, causing dozens of dangerous yokai to be released.
  • Retired Badass: Implied with Yuichi's auntie. She's a humble farmer in the present, but owns a named sword (Edgewing), is surprisingly acrobatic for an old lady, has a wooden ear and a prosthetic leg and used to teach the skilled Yuichi. All of which hints at a very tumultuous past.
  • What the Hell, Hero?: Gen calls Yuichi out on just assuming that Warimachi was an innocent pig while Gen himself was a brutish thug, just because they look cute and intimidating respectively.
